mongodb show fields in collection

Angelo Vertti, 18 de setembro de 2022

MongoDB Compass - Collections Enter the name of a collection, check appropriate checkbox and click on the Create Collectionbutton to create it. Show the example below. Specifies the read concern. Executing db.collection.find () in mongosh automatically iterates the cursor to display up to the first 20 documents. MongoDB stores data records as documents(specifically BSON documents) which are gathered together in collections. Let us create a collection with documents > db.demo30 . MongoDB Aggregate a sub field of an array (Array is main field) Hot Network Questions Ranked voting by a committee when some members cannot vote for a particular candidate because of a conflict of interest <collectionName> .find () - or -. keys (db.teams.findOne()) This query returns the following documents: [ '_id', 'team', 'points', 'rebounds', 'assists' ] Notice that the list of field names also includes the _id field, which MongoDB automatically . The query is as follows The query is as follows > db.getCollectionNames().forEach(function(myCollectionName) { . Example: The following block of code is used to return the specific field of the MongoDB collection. Filter specific values from a MongoDB document; How to select objects where an array contains only a specific field in MongoDB? Statistics Made Easy. A databasestores one or more collections of documents. Show collections List collections getCollectionNames () getCollectionInfos () To get only the name of the collection and views show collections is the best command to show all collections from the database. To create a new collection using MongoDB Compass, connect compass to your server and select the database. select a database to use, in mongosh, issue the use <db>statement, as in the following example: use myDB Let's get comprehend this with the help of an example. In order to display the indexes of a collection, you can use getIndexes (). Click on the "Create Collection" button to create a new collection, as shown below. If we want to fetch the "user_id" , "password" and "date_of_jon" for all documents from the collection 'userdetails' which hold the educational qualification "M.C.A.", the following mongodb command can be used : In the python code, first, we import the pymongo library to access the MongoDB database. Calculators; Critical Value Tables; Glossary; Posted on November 8, 2021 by Zach . Let us implement the above syntax in order to find all documents in MongoDB with field name "StudentFirstName". Collection.find(query, projection); // query - query for filtering out the data // projection - Specifies the fields to return in the documents that match the query filter Now check the format of . The uom field remains embedded in the size document. Restrictions. Statology. document. MongoDB supports draft 4 of JSON Schema, including core specification and validation specification, with some differences. Databases In MongoDB, databases hold one or more collections of documents. Context. The following example returns: The _id field (returned by default), The item field, The status field, The uom field in the size document. Use the dot notation to refer to the embedded field and set to 1 in the projection document. Select the database to use and list collections: > show dbs > use <databaseName> > show collections. Optional. The following tutorials explain how to perform other common tasks in MongoDB: MongoDB: How to Rename Fields MongoDB: How to Remove Fields MongoDB: How to Check if Field Contains a String MongoDB: How to Query with a Date Range MongoDB: How to Query with "Like" Regex Fetch more than one fields from collection based on a criteria . In MongoDB, we can show collections and views using a different method. Get all the column names in a table in MongoDB; How to re-map the fields of a MongoDB collection? Tip Iterate the Returned Cursor Modify the Cursor Behavior Available mongosh Menu . How do I add a new field to an existing record in MongoDB? How to retrieve all nested fields from MongoDB collection? Update only a specific value in a MongoDB document; Display only a single field from all the documents in a MongoDB collection; MongoDB query to return only embedded document? For more information about JSON Schema, see the official website. Selecting only a single field from MongoDB? The syntax is as follows db.yourCollectionName.getIndexes (); To understand the concept, let us create a collection with the document. By default, the find () and findOne () methods return all fields in matching documents. For details, see Extensions and Omissions. You can use JSON schema to specify validation rules for your fields in a human-readable format. Below is the method which was used to show collections. Search for jobs related to Mongodb show fields in collection or hire on the world's largest freelancing marketplace with 19m+ jobs. Type it to continue iteration. Right-click - Right-click on the field with embedded field (s) and choose Show Embedded Fields or Hide Embedded Fields Hotkey - Press Ctrl + Enter (^ + Enter) Show or hide all embedded fields To show (or hide) all embedded fields within a MongoDB collection, right-click on any field and choose Show All Embedded Fields or Hide All Embedded Fields. User.collection.aggregate (. ).to_a) You can use the official mongodb reference when writing in Mongoid, usually you just need to use double quote on the property name on the left hand side, to make it work on Mongoid. The following code shows how to list all field names in the teams collection: Object. Share answered Jul 8, 2019 at 5:23 Andy First, select the database you want to view the collection. Now let's select the name field. This tutorial explains how to remove a field from every document in a collection in MongoDB, including examples. Starting in MongoDB 3.6, the readConcern option has the following syntax: readConcern: { level: <value> } Execute one of the following commands to show collection data in MongoDB: > db. This lets you insert documents that do not meet the validation requirements. Launch and Manage MongoDB View and Analyze Start with Guides Community Education Developer Center Events & Webinars Forums Champions Find a User Group University Certification Academia MongoDB Basics Course Browse All Courses Company About Services Partnerships Who We Are Blog Careers Pressroom Leadership Investors Consulting To add field or fields to embedded documents (including documents in arrays) use the dot notation. About; Course; Basic Stats; Machine Learning; Software Tutorials. Skip to content. You can return specific fields in an embedded document. Excel; Google Sheets; MongoDB; Python; R; SAS; SPSS; Stata; TI-84; Tools. Get all embedded documents with "isMarried" status in a MongoDB collection; Get execution stats in MongoDB for a collection . Most of the time you don't need data from all the fields. so you can find it like this (this would be on the client, and you would have already subscribed to DBInfos collection): let userId = Meteor.userId (); let matchingInfos = DBInfos.find ( {userId: userId}); the first userId is the name of the field in the collection, the second is the local variable that came from the logged in user. > use mydb > show collections Output: TECADMIN accounts mycol pproducts users Get Collections Information The query to create a collection with a document is as follows You can't specify schema validation for . MongoDB collection query to exclude some fields in find()? To show collection data in MongoDB, first of all start the mongo shell: $ mongo. It's free to sign up and bid on jobs. readConcern. Read More . Mongodb Show Collection Select your database and run show collections command to list available collections in MongoDB database. Enables db.collection.aggregate () to bypass document validation during the operation. To select fields to return from a query, you can specify them in a document and pass the document to the find () and . Retrieving a Subset of Fields from MongoDB - To retried a subset of fields, use dot notation in find(). Inorder to do that, we need to first understand the mongoDB query syntax db.countries.find( // For basic filtering based on the key values passed {}, // for selecting the fields {} ); You can pass the second parameter to the find method. To access the returned documents with a driver, use the appropriate cursor handling mechanism for the driver language. It will work for findOne too. Using a variety of different examples, we have learned how to solve the How To Update Mongodb Collection With A New Field. In MongoDB, projection simply means selecting fields to return from a query. If you try to inspect the record, you can convert it into an array first (e.g. Example: List All Field Names in MongoDB. In this topic, you will learn to return the specific field of a MongoDB collection using python.

Linksys Ea6350 Lights, Ssp High Uniformity Burrs, Best Recruitment Agencies In Gauteng, Fortiswitch 248d Datasheet, Hardware Asset Management Definition, Gien French China From Tiffany, Automatic Shift Knob Honda Civic,